Top PVP Games Performance in Poland Q1 2025
Explore the performance trends of the top PVP games on a unified platform in Poland during Q1 2025, with insights from Sensor Tower.
In the first quarter of 2025, the performance of top PVP games on a unified platform in Poland showcased varied trends in downloads, revenue, and active users. Here's a closer look at how these games fared:
Coin Master from Moon Active saw a gradual decline in weekly revenue, starting at approximately $729K and tapering to around $571K by the end of March. Downloads also decreased steadily from 16K to just over 3K. However, weekly active users remained relatively stable, fluctuating around 280K.
Whiteout Survival by Century Games experienced consistent revenue, maintaining figures around $340K to $396K throughout the quarter. The game’s downloads decreased from 44K to 19K, while active users dropped from 166K to 125K, suggesting a tightening user base.
Roblox, by Roblox Corporation, witnessed a decrease in revenue from $382K to $176K over the quarter. Downloads fluctuated between 42K and 32K, and active users saw a small decline from 2M to 1.8M, indicating steady engagement.
Match Masters from Candivore LTD showed a varied pattern, with revenue peaking at $189K mid-January and settling around $153K by the end of March. Downloads remained between 16K and 9K, while active users showed minor fluctuations around 200K.
Lastly, Royal Match by Dream Games maintained a fairly stable revenue, hovering between $163K and $170K. Downloads ranged from 19K to 13K, and active users stayed consistent around 240K.
